Occhidiangela,Mar 7 2005, 10:25 AM Wrote:Why a Chinese  Farmer?
[right][snapback]69897[/snapback][/right]

MySuperSales and IGE are based out of Beijing sweatshops that "hire" people to play EQ, or WOW, maybe others to farm and then sell virtual gold or items via real world dollars.

I think the reason they tend to be from there is that in most other places in the regulated world of commerce, Vivendi could exercise a cease and desist order to shut them down.

Rinnhart,Mar 7 2005, 05:10 PM Wrote:Their site says Hong Kong, and Yantis (mysupersales) is supposed to be still based out of Florida. But I've heard Beijing mentioned before in regards to IGE; can you site your source?
[right][snapback]69951[/snapback][/right]

WHOIS: MySuperSales.COM

IGE Corporate Officers (Includes: Chief Strategic Officer: Jonathan Yantis)

I would like to give you the street address in Beijing where LOLY or the "Liu Zhi Qin Mo" are holed up, but I've not found that as yet. Much of it is from incidental conversations I've read that people have reported while trying to engage in conversations with farmers online. As I understand their business model, the actual farming is subcontracted to the sweat shops coordinated through Hong Kong. Hong Kong provides the low cost labor of telemarketing and tech support, but probably not the farmers themselves. It might be very likely that the farmers are from all over the region, and not just China. But, China makes the most sense.
